Summary
Originally commissioned by Jacqueline Kennedy Onassis to commemorate the memory of John F. Kennedy, Mass mixes aspects of classical, pop, jazz, rock and blues music. Structured like a Roman Catholic Mass, it contains both text from the Roman liturgy as well as original pieces. Rarely performed due to the enormity of the production, Mass features more than two hundred performers among the large orchestra, a rock band, a blues band, 18 soloists, 80 chorus singers, and a company of 45 dancer-singers
